Correct Incorrect Formed in 1998, B2K was an R&B boy band managed by Chris Stokes. The final addition to the original lineup was Omarion, and in 2001, the group achieved success with their song "Uh-Huh," reaching the top forty pop hits. Despite the success of "Pandemonium," the group officially announced their breakup in 2004. Subsequently, Omarion embarked on his solo career, with management provided by Chris Stokes.
